Transaction c66679d4cc5dbd444df6efdcbba478b188c7a58930ee5b7ccf95e38d3e903ccc

1 Input
2 Outputs
  • c66679d4cc5dbd444df6efdcbba478b188c7a58930ee5b7ccf95e38d3e903ccc:0
  • value  558258
    address  32BW9arVpJbCGh2PTrcTR8Sxh8eJqydEHM
  • c66679d4cc5dbd444df6efdcbba478b188c7a58930ee5b7ccf95e38d3e903ccc:1
  • value  695471
    address  134RMQ3ro6YMTS8bnmA5dbSKtVre5eQaGY